Nigerian Government Digitizes 31 Ministries Ahead of Paperless Deadline

The Nigerian government has declared that 31 ministries and extra ministerial departments have successfully transitioned to a fully digital and paperless civil service. This move is part of the government's aim to achieve a fully digitized civil service by December 31, 2025.
Didi Esther Walson Jack, the Head of the Federal Civil Service, made the announcement during a paperless civil service gala in Abuja. The initiative is part of the Federal Civil Service Strategy Implementation Plan (FCSSIP) 2021-2025, aiming to digitize work processes across government agencies using the 1Gov Cloud and 1Gov framework.
Professor Ibrahim Adeyanju, the Managing Director and CEO of Galaxy Backbone Limited, described the initiative as a landmark in Nigeria's digital transformation journey, emphasizing efficiency, transparency, and service excellence.
